|  | //@ revisions: align16 align1024 | 
|  | //@ compile-flags: -C no-prepopulate-passes -Z mir-opt-level=0 -Clink-dead-code | 
|  | //@ [align16] compile-flags: -Zmin-function-alignment=16 | 
|  | //@ [align1024] compile-flags: -Zmin-function-alignment=1024 | 
|  | //@ ignore-wasm32 aligning functions is not currently supported on wasm (#143368) | 
|  |  | 
|  | #![crate_type = "lib"] | 
|  | // FIXME(#82232, #143834): temporarily renamed to mitigate `#[align]` nameres ambiguity | 
|  | #![feature(rustc_attrs)] | 
|  | #![feature(fn_align)] | 
|  |  | 
|  | // Functions without explicit alignment use the global minimum. | 
|  | // | 
|  | // NOTE: this function deliberately has zero (0) attributes! That is to make sure that | 
|  | // `-Zmin-function-alignment` is applied regardless of whether attributes are used. | 
|  | // | 
|  | // CHECK-LABEL: no_explicit_align | 
|  | // align16: align 16 | 
|  | // align1024: align 1024 | 
|  | pub fn no_explicit_align() {} | 
|  |  | 
|  | // CHECK-LABEL: @lower_align | 
|  | // align16: align 16 | 
|  | // align1024: align 1024 | 
|  | #[no_mangle] | 
|  | #[rustc_align(8)] | 
|  | pub fn lower_align() {} | 
|  |  | 
|  | // the higher value of min-function-alignment and the align attribute wins out | 
|  | // | 
|  | // CHECK-LABEL: @higher_align | 
|  | // align16: align 32 | 
|  | // align1024: align 1024 | 
|  | #[no_mangle] | 
|  | #[rustc_align(32)] | 
|  | pub fn higher_align() {} | 
|  |  | 
|  | // cold functions follow the same rules as other functions | 
|  | // | 
|  | // in GCC, the `-falign-functions` does not apply to cold functions, but | 
|  | // `-Zmin-function-alignment` applies to all functions. | 
|  | // | 
|  | // CHECK-LABEL: @no_explicit_align_cold | 
|  | // align16: align 16 | 
|  | // align1024: align 1024 | 
|  | #[no_mangle] | 
|  | #[cold] | 
|  | pub fn no_explicit_align_cold() {} |
